Sommario

  1. Introduzione

  2. Perché i report personalizzati sono importanti in Dolibarr

  3. Funzionalità di reporting integrate in Dolibarr

  4. Comprensione della struttura dei dati di Dolibarr

  5. Ruoli utente e autorizzazioni di accesso per i report

  6. Tipi di report personalizzati che puoi creare

  7. Utilizzo delle funzioni di esportazione integrate (CSV, XLS)

  8. Creazione di report con il modulo Report personalizzati di Dolibarr

  9. Creazione di report con SQL Builder (nessuna codifica richiesta)

  10. Utilizzo di strumenti esterni: LibreOffice, Excel, Fogli Google

  11. Automazione della generazione di report con attività pianificate

  12. Combinazione di più moduli in un unico report

  13. Gestione di filtri e parametri per report dinamici

  14. Visualizzare i dati con diagrammi e diagrammi

  15. Gestione e condivisione di report personalizzati

  16. Esportazione di report personalizzati per contabilità o conformità

  17. Casi d'uso comuni: vendite, inventario, progetti, risorse umane

  18. Opzioni avanzate con PHP e moduli personalizzati (facoltativo)

  19. Best practice per la progettazione di report personalizzati

  20. Conclusione: prendi il controllo della tua Business Intelligence


1. introduzione

Dolibarr ERP/CRM è una potente piattaforma open source che aiuta le piccole e medie imprese a gestire ogni aspetto, dalle vendite alla fatturazione, dall'inventario alle risorse umane. Sebbene l'interfaccia predefinita offra numerosi report integrati, molti utenti raggiungono un punto in cui necessitano di informazioni più personalizzate. Che si tratti di una dashboard sulle performance di vendita, di un registro dei movimenti di inventario o di un report sulle attività dei clienti, i report personalizzati sono la soluzione ideale.

Questo articolo illustra tutti gli strumenti e le tecniche che puoi utilizzare per creare report personalizzati in Dolibarr, senza necessariamente scrivere codice. Al termine, avrai una comprensione pratica e strategica di come trasformare Dolibarr nel tuo hub di business intelligence.


2. Perché i report personalizzati sono importanti in Dolibarr

Ogni azienda è diversa. Le metriche e i KPI che ti interessano potrebbero non essere inclusi nei report Dolibarr predefiniti. I report personalizzati ti consentono di:

  • Concentrati sui dati che contano

  • Combina informazioni da più moduli

  • Esporta i dati nei formati di cui il tuo contabile o il tuo management ha bisogno

  • Automatizza i report ricorrenti per i team

  • Prendi decisioni basate sui dati più velocemente

Grazie ai report personalizzati, Dolibarr si trasforma da uno strumento di archiviazione dati in un sistema decisionale strategico.


3. Funzionalità di reporting integrate in Dolibarr

Dolibarr è dotato di diversi report standard:

  • Fatturato e fatture

  • Saldi dei clienti non pagati

  • Livelli e movimenti delle scorte

  • Registri delle presenze e degli stipendi dei dipendenti

  • Monitoraggio delle attività del progetto

Questi report sono accessibili tramite i rispettivi moduli e spesso includono filtri e opzioni di ordinamento. Sebbene utili, potrebbero non rispondere a domande aziendali più specifiche o complesse.


4. Comprensione della struttura dei dati di Dolibarr

Prima di creare qualsiasi report, è essenziale capire come Dolibarr storedati:

  • Ogni modulo corrisponde a una o più tabelle nel database.

  • Le tabelle hanno chiavi esterne che collegano clienti, fatture, prodotti, ecc.

  • Dolibarr utilizza un sistema di prefissi (ad esempio, llx_product, llx_societe, llx_facture)

Conoscere le relazioni tra i moduli aiuta a creare report accurati, soprattutto quando si utilizzano strumenti basati su SQL.


5. Ruoli utente e autorizzazioni di accesso per i report

Solo gli utenti con autorizzazioni sufficienti possono visualizzare o creare report personalizzati. Gli amministratori possono concedere diritti specifici per i report accedendo a: Impostazioni > Utenti e gruppi > Autorizzazioni

Assicurarsi:

  • I dati sensibili sono accessibili solo agli utenti autorizzati

  • I diritti di esportazione sono limitati in base al ruolo

  • I report non espongono involontariamente informazioni riservate


6. Tipi di report personalizzati che puoi creare

I report personalizzati possono coprire un'ampia gamma di casi d'uso:

  • Vendite rapporti: per prodotto, per regione, per venditore

  • Rapporti dei clienti: clienti attivi vs. dormienti, importo medio della fattura

  • Inventario: rotazione delle scorte, avvisi di scorte basse, monitoraggio del magazzino

  • Amministrazione: flusso di cassa mensile, crediti scaduti, previsioni di pagamento

  • HR: analisi delle retribuzioni, saldi delle ferie, durate dei contratti

  • Progetti: ore registrate, budget vs. effettivo


7. Utilizzo delle funzioni di esportazione integrate (CSV, XLS)

La maggior parte degli elenchi Dolibarr (fatture, prodotti, clienti) includono un Esportare pulsante. Questo ti permette di:

  • Scegli i campi da includere

  • Imposta i filtri prima dell'esportazione

  • Scarica il formato CSV o Excel

Una volta esportati, è possibile creare report in Excel, LibreOffice Calc o Fogli Google utilizzando tabelle pivot o formule.


8. Creazione di report con il modulo Report personalizzati di Dolibarr

Dolibarr include un Report Modulo che consente di definire e salvare query personalizzate. Per utilizzarlo:

  1. Vai su Home > Rapporti

  2. Scegli una categoria (vendite, prodotti, ecc.)

  3. Utilizza filtri e criteri per generare risultati

  4. Salva il report con un nome e diritti di accesso

Sebbene non offra visualizzazioni avanzate, fornisce solidi riepiloghi basati su tabelle per uso interno.


9. Creazione di report con SQL Builder (nessuna codifica richiesta)

Per gli utenti che hanno familiarità con le strutture del database ma non con PHP, Dolibarr supporta direttamente i report SQL:

  • Accedere a Home > Strumenti > Report SQL

  • Scrivi la tua query SQL

  • Risultati dei test e dell'anteprima

  • Salva e condividi con altri utenti

È perfetto per generare report complessi, composti da più tabelle, come "I 10 principali clienti con fatture non pagate da oltre 90 giorni".


10. Utilizzo di strumenti esterni: LibreOffice, Excel, Fogli Google

Per report e visualizzazioni flessibili, esporta i tuoi dati Dolibarr e lavora esternamente. Flussi di lavoro di esempio:

  • Connettiti al database di Dolibarr tramite ODBC/JDBC (per utenti avanzati)

  • Utilizzare script o cron job per esportare i dati quotidianamente

  • Carica in Fogli Google con plugin per dashboard live

Questo approccio ibrido consente un'elevata personalizzazione senza modificare direttamente Dolibarr.


11. Automazione della generazione di report con attività pianificate

Dolibarr supporta i cron job per le attività di routine. Puoi:

  • Pianificare le esportazioni giornaliere dei dati del report

  • Invia report via email agli utenti selezionati

  • Esegui query SQL e invia l'output ai file

Usa il Impostazioni > Strumenti > Attività pianificate per definire l'automazione. Combinalo con script shell per pipeline di report complete.


12. Combinazione di più moduli in un unico report

Vuoi sapere come le vendite sono collegate alle scorte o i clienti ai pagamenti? Utilizza join SQL o esporta dati da:

  • llx_facture per fatture

  • llx_commande per gli ordini

  • llx_stock_mouvement per variazioni di stock

  • llx_societe per i clienti

Combinando questi dati è possibile ottenere visualizzazioni complete come "Redditività del cliente per categoria di prodotto".


13. Gestione di filtri e parametri per report dinamici

Quando si creano query personalizzate, è consigliabile aggiungere parametri:

  • Intervalli di date (WHERE date >= 'YYYY-MM-DD')

  • Categorie di prodotti o tipologie di clienti

  • Filtri regionali o per venditori

Il filtraggio dinamico migliora la riutilizzabilità dei report in contesti o periodi diversi.


14. Visualizzare i dati con diagrammi e diagrammi

Dolibarr offre funzionalità di creazione di grafici limitate. Per una visualizzazione migliore:

  • Esporta in Excel o Fogli Google

  • Utilizzare tabelle pivot + grafici

  • Importa CSV in strumenti come Tableau o Power BI

Per gli sviluppatori è anche possibile l'integrazione con librerie come Chart.js all'interno di moduli Dolibarr personalizzati.


15. Gestione e condivisione di report personalizzati

Mantieni i report organizzati:

  • Utilizzare nomi chiari e descrittivi

  • Filtri e logica dei documenti nei commenti o nelle note

  • Memorizza report condivisi in una directory comune o in un modulo dashboard

È possibile assegnare diritti di visibilità ai gruppi di utenti per limitare i dati sensibili.


16. Esportazione di report personalizzati per la contabilità o la conformità

Le aziende francesi potrebbero aver bisogno di report formattati per:

  • File FEC (Fichier des Écritures Comptables)

  • Relazioni di chiusura di fine anno

  • Verifiche fiscali

Il modulo di contabilità di Dolibarr supporta alcune esportazioni, ma i report SQL personalizzati possono soddisfare esigenze specifiche, come l'analisi a livello di segmento.


17. Casi d'uso comuni: vendite, inventario, progetti, risorse umane

Sconti:

  • Fatturato mensile per cliente

  • Rapporto vincite/perdite per venditore

Inventario:

  • Variazione giornaliera delle scorte

  • Margine di prodotto per magazzino

Progetti:

  • Ore registrate per consulente

  • Budget vs. tempo effettivamente speso

HR:

  • Assenza per reparto

  • Evoluzione salariale per tipologia contrattuale


18. Opzioni avanzate con PHP e moduli personalizzati (facoltativo)

Se sei esperto di tecnologia o hai il supporto di uno sviluppatore, Dolibarr può essere esteso con moduli personalizzati:

  • Utilizzare PHP per generare dashboard

  • Crea file Excel esportabili con TCPDF o PhpSpreadsheet

  • Crea grafici in tempo reale con JavaScript incorporato

Per la maggior parte degli utenti questa funzionalità non è obbligatoria, ma offre una flessibilità infinita per i KPI personalizzati.


19. Best practice per la progettazione di report personalizzati

  • Convalida le tue fonti dati prima di creare

  • Mantenere i report mirati e fruibili

  • Utilizzare nomi di campo ed etichette coerenti

  • Documentare le ipotesi e la logica utilizzata

  • Report di prova con casi limite (ad esempio, zero vendite, nuovi clienti)


20. Conclusione: prendi il controllo della tua Business Intelligence

Dolibarr è più di un ERP: è la base per un processo decisionale consapevole. Grazie agli strumenti integrati, ai report SQL, alle integrazioni esterne e alle funzionalità di automazione, chiunque può creare report personalizzati e potenti senza dover scrivere codice. Con obiettivi chiari, un minimo di struttura e il corretto utilizzo delle sue funzionalità, Dolibarr diventa una risorsa strategica, aiutandovi a trasformare i dati grezzi in strategie aziendali intelligenti.